Best Travel Destinations In India During June

It depends where you live in India. June is the month, which is in the midst of hot summer in India. Generally people in India prefer to travel to hill stations, which are located in different regions of India.

Times have also changed and you wont find it a surprise that people from north travel down to south Indian hill stations and vice versa.

For example, people who live in north, prefer to go to Shimla, Kulu & Manali. Kashmir is the most preferred destination though.

People from the Western India, have places like Lonavala, Khandala and other hill stations in the neighbouring states.

Best Travel Destinations In Quebec Outside Of Montreal And Quebec City

Definitely the Gaspésie region… The town of Gaspé itself is beautiful, the town of Percé is a must-see, and for nature-lovers and mountain-climbers, you mustn’t miss the Parc de la Gaspésie (a national park & campground, with trails over the second-highest mountain range in Quebec).

Also, the Jardins de Métis is a fine place to visit if you like botanical gardens.

Some cities that you should see are Trois-Rivières, Sherbrooke, Drummondville, Mont-Tremblant (and the rest of the “ski” region), Gatineau (federal capital region), Rouyn-Noranda, Sept-Îles (north coast of the Saint-Lawrence), Schefferville (north of Labrador City). Some of those are pretty big and accessible, others are smaller and remote.

If you’re feeling adventurous and/or you like to hunt, Anticosti Island is a fun and unique place to visit. It’s only accessible by occasional ferries and charter flights.

Another area to definitely check out if you have the time is the Nunavik region. You can drive as far north as the towns of Chisasibi (a Cree village) and Radisson (where there’s a major hydro dam), up the James Bay highway. You can fly to native villages like Kuujjuaq as well.

Finally, a very beautiful and oft-overlooked region is the Îles-de-la-Madeleine. This is a small island off the coast of Prince Edward Island, mainly accessible by ferry from Souris. There’s also a cruise ship/ferry from Montreal that sails to the isles.

Camping

If you’re an outdoors type of person, camping is an even cheaper option than cruises. You can enjoy outdoor activities like hiking, fishing, and boating. If you’re a dog owner, one advantage of camping is that you can take your dog, or dogs, with you.

If you need to buy equipment, shop around to save yourself some money. Avoid the large stores. Check out the prices of equipment online. Search on the internet and on Ebay. You can save even more money by borrowing equipment off friends and family.

Take as much as your own food with you as you can. This will save you from paying the much higher prices for basics that holiday resorts charge.

One obvious disadvantage of camping is the weather. Check out the weather forecasts and try to pick a time when the weather is expected to be good.

All Inclusive Packages

All inclusive can be cheap vacation packages and allow you to know how much you will be spending beforehand. You will know how much the vacation will cost and not have to worry about other charges and hidden fees.

You can save even more money if you go out of season. If you find a resort where all the meals and drinks are included in the price, it works out even cheaper. Don’t forget to search online for discount coupons and check out the cash back websites to earn money back on your purchase.
